Presentation: Why 78% of Your Organization Couldn’t Care Less About Your Transformation Project and What to Do About It

Abstract: Most transformation projects fail to achieve their goals because, quite simply, the majority of employees don’t care. In fact, research shows that 78% of employees are disengaged during transformation initiatives, leading to missed opportunities, poor execution, and ultimately, project failure. In this session, we’ll delve into the root causes of this disengagement and examine its impact on project outcomes.

Attendees will gain valuable insights into why employees disconnect from transformation efforts and how this directly affects project success. The session will provide practical tools and strategies to help project managers influence and re-engage their teams, even in complex organizational settings. Participants will leave equipped with clear, actionable steps to drive alignment, execution, and sustainable success in their transformation projects.
